Cost of Living Mexican Nuevo Pesos are actually demarcated with a $ sign, so to distinguish from the US Dollars (US$) that are also in use, especially in areas frequented by tourists, the symbols M$, N$ or NP are found. It is worthwhile keeping the current exchange rate in mind, as some establishments offer better deals when paying in Dollars rather than Pesos and vice versa. One-litre bottle of mineral water: M$8 33cl bottle of beer: M$8 Financial Times newspapers: British newspapers not available 36-exposure colour film: M$55 City-centre bus ticket: M$1.50 Adult football ticket: M$1-10 Three-course meal with wine/beer: M$120 M$ = £0.08; US$0.11; C$0.17; A$0.22 US$1 = £0.699; C$1.579; A$2.057 Currency conversion rates as of April 2001 |
